Nadya Suleman has entered a 30-day treatment program at Chapman House Drug Rehabilitation Center in Southern California to get help with an addiction to Xanax.
The woman dubbed ‘Octomom’ after giving birth to octuplets in January 2009, got hooked on an anti-anxiety drug that she began taking to deal with the stress of raising 14 children who were conceived via IVF and sperm donors.
Suleman’s rep revealed, “Nadya wanted to get off the Xanax she was prescribed by her doctor and learn to deal with her stress, exhaustion and anxiety with professional help from a team of doctors. Nadya wanted to deal with her issues and make sure she is the best mother she can be.”
The kids have been left in the care of three nannies and two friends, and a driver who transports the older youngsters to and from school.
